test
{
XCLAIM can claim PEL items from another consumer
}
{
# Add 3 items into the stream, and create a consumer group
r del mystream
set id1
[
r XADD mystream * a 1
]
set id2
[
r XADD mystream * b 2
]
set id3
[
r XADD mystream * c 3
]
r XGROUP CREATE mystream mygroup 0
# Client 1 reads item 1 from the stream without acknowledgements.
# Client 2 then claims pending item 1 from the PEL of client 1
set reply
[
r XREADGROUP GROUP mygroup client1 count 1 STREAMS mystream >
]
assert
{[
llength
[
lindex $reply 0 1 0 1
]]
== 2
}
assert
{[
lindex $reply 0 1 0 1
]
eq
{
a 1
}}
r debug sleep 0.2
set reply
[
r XCLAIM mystream mygroup client2 10 $id1
]
assert
{[
llength
[
lindex $reply 0 1
]]
== 2
}
assert
{[
lindex $reply 0 1
]
eq
{
a 1
}}
# Client 1 reads another 2 items from stream
r XREADGROUP GROUP mygroup client1 count 2 STREAMS mystream >
r debug sleep 0.2
# Delete item 2 from the stream. Now client 1 has PEL that contains
# only item 3. Try to use client 2 to claim the deleted item 2
# from the PEL of client 1, this should return nil
r XDEL mystream $id2
set reply
[
r XCLAIM mystream mygroup client2 10 $id2
]
assert
{[
llength $reply
]
== 1
}
assert_equal
""
[
lindex $reply 0
]
# Delete item 3 from the stream. Now client 1 has PEL that is empty.
# Try to use client 2 to claim the deleted item 3 from the PEL
# of client 1, this should return nil
r debug sleep 0.2
r XDEL mystream $id3
set reply
[
r XCLAIM mystream mygroup client2 10 $id3
]
assert
{[
llength $reply
]
== 1
}
assert_equal
""
[
lindex $reply 0
]
}
